Get ready to dive into the vibrant world of Karetus, the Portuguese electronic music duo that is redefining bass music with an unmistakable Lusitanian touch. Formed in 2010 by Carlos Silva and André Reis, this duo quickly stood out for a no-holds-barred approach, mixing genres in an explosion they themselves dubbed “Full Flavor.”

It’s not just about the beats; Karetus’s visual identity is as striking as their music, bringing a unique aesthetic to the stage inspired by the caretos, the masked figures from the traditional carnival celebrations of northern Portugal. These masks and costumes, which combine traditional craftsmanship with digital technology, transform every performance into a visually epic spectacle deeply rooted in culture.

Their debut album, Piñata (2015), was a milestone, helping to solidify their position both nationally and internationally, at a time when major labels like Rottun Recordings and Buygore already had their eyes on them. From then on, the Karetus machine hasn’t stopped, releasing a series of EPs and singles that proved their versatility and capacity for innovation.

The Karetus sound is a rollercoaster, ranging from electronic dance music to more aggressive bass music, but always with a tendency to integrate unexpected elements. They demonstrate a singular talent for fusion, where electronica meets traditional sounds from Portugal and the Lusophone world.

This became evident in more recent projects, such as the “Modas” concept, which explicitly aims to export and present an impactful live show, connecting Portuguese roots to the international electronic music audience. The focus on singles like “Laurinda” and “Moleirinha,” which explore Lusophone oral tradition, underscores this mission of cultural appreciation.

Collaborations with other artists are a constant, and Karetus is not afraid to bring together different musical universes, as they did with Padre Guilherme and Ricardo Luís Campos on “Ave Maria” or with Conan Osiris, Isabel Silvestre, and Júlio Pereira on “Moleirinha,” showing that fusion is their DNA. Their presence at the Festival da Canção (Portuguese national song contest) in 2018 proved they were ready for any stage, without ever compromising their style.

The stages, in fact, are the natural habitat of this duo, who have toured festivals across Portugal and beyond, bringing their infectious energy and the “Full Flavor” spirit to thousands of fans. It is in the live context that the symbiosis between high-energy music and the caretos aesthetic reaches its peak, creating an immersive and unforgettable experience.
